Very Dizzy Bp Normal?

Lately I've been super dizzy but my BP is pretty good. Any reasons why this happens?? My lower extremites are tingley/on the verge of being numb....Any advice is greatly appreciated.

This is something that I have been trying to get an explanation for ...dizziness that cant be explained away by hypotension...

If you look up some of the research ,esp that coming out of Mayo, hypocapnea (low CO2) would seem to be the answer ...It would explain the tingling and numbness you experience . So far Ive not been able to find out how you correct this...going around breathing into a brown bag seems a little silly....

For hypocapnea, check out the Buteyko method. It is a breathing technique developed to slightly increase CO2 retention which helps all kinds of problems.

I hope the dizziness goes away. I get it when my BB peaks, also when the smog is bad, also when the barometer is low.

so I checked out the Butyeko method ..which I had never heard of.. on a superficial scan it would seem to suggest that shallow breathing with a pause after expiration would increase levels of CO2...as a PT I had already kind of worked that out for myself. However I do find trying to get any sort of voluntary control over my breathing very difficult ..I seem to get mild panic at any attempt....My one and only panic attack happened when I tried some slow deep breathing during an episode of SOB..so I am very wary of trying to alter my breathing pattern .

I also note the research done on this method does not seem to indicate an increase in CO2 levels in those taking part in the study ..
